The Power of Jamstack in Web Development

The Power of Jamstack in Web Development

Introduction

The Power of Jamstack in Web Development. The web development landscape is constantly evolving, and one approach that has gained serious traction in recent years is Jamstack. Although it might sound like a trendy buzzword, Jamstack offers tangible benefits for developers, businesses, and end users. Fast loading times, improved security, easier scaling, and a developer-friendly workflow make it a compelling choice.

In this article, we’ll explore what Jamstack is, why it’s powerful, and how it’s reshaping modern web development. Whether you’re a freelance developer, an agency owner, or a business exploring digital transformation, Jamstack might just be the missing piece in your strategy.

What is Jamstack? A New Approach to Building the Web

Jamstack is an architecture designed to make the web faster, more secure, and easier to scale. The term “JAM” stands for:

  • JavaScript: Handles dynamic functionalities
  • APIs: Used for server-side operations and database calls
  • Markup: Pre-built HTML files served via a Content Delivery Network (CDN)

Instead of relying on traditional monolithic systems like WordPress or Drupal, which process requests on the server at runtime, Jamstack sites are typically pre-rendered and deployed as static files. This makes the delivery process incredibly fast and resilient.

Platforms like Netlify, Vercel, and Cloudflare Pages have made it easy for developers to adopt the Jamstack workflow without worrying about backend infrastructure.

For a more in-depth look at how Jamstack works, you can refer to this comprehensive guide from Jamstack.org.

Why Jamstack is Gaining Popularity

The rise of Jamstack isn’t just about hype—it addresses real pain points in traditional web development. Here’s why developers and businesses are embracing it:

1. Performance That Matters

Jamstack sites are usually served directly from CDNs. This results in lightning-fast loading times, which is crucial for user experience and SEO. Google has made it clear that Core Web Vitals—metrics like loading speed and interactivity—are key ranking factors. With Jamstack, performance is baked in from the start.

Fact: According to Google’s research, a one-second delay in page load time can lead to a 20% drop in conversions.

2. Improved Security

Because Jamstack decouples the frontend from the backend, there’s a much smaller attack surface. You’re not running a server or database with every page load. This minimizes the risks associated with SQL injections, cross-site scripting, and server misconfigurations.

Many large companies now prefer Jamstack as it reduces vulnerabilities by removing traditional backend dependencies.

3. Scalability Without Headaches

Scaling traditional web apps means managing servers, databases, and infrastructure. With Jamstack, scaling is effortless. The CDN handles it. If your site suddenly goes viral, there’s no backend server to crash—just static files being served at scale.

This is particularly beneficial for ecommerce sites during flash sales or content sites with sudden traffic spikes.

4. Developer Experience

For developers, Jamstack is pure joy. You write code locally, use Git-based workflows, and push updates with a single command. Frameworks like Next.js, Gatsby, and Nuxt.js have made it easy to adopt this architecture.

Version control is simple, testing is streamlined, and deploying updates is a breeze. Developers can focus on building features instead of managing infrastructure.

Real-World Use Cases of Jamstack

Jamstack isn’t just a theoretical improvement—it’s being used by top-tier companies and solo creators alike. Here are some real-world applications:

  • Ecommerce: Brands like Nike and Louis Vuitton use Jamstack for speed and scale. Fast product pages = more conversions.
  • Documentation Sites: Tech companies like Stripe, Twilio, and Netlify use Jamstack to serve developer documentation that loads instantly.
  • Blogs and Portfolios: Many personal sites, including those of designers and developers, run on Jamstack for simplicity and performance.

Jamstack vs Traditional CMS: A Quick Comparison

FeatureJamstackTraditional CMS (e.g., WordPress)
Page Load SpeedVery fast (CDN-based)Moderate (server-rendered)
SecurityHigh (no server runtime)Medium to Low
ScalabilityEffortlessRequires backend scaling
Developer FlexibilityHigh (modular and API-first)Limited by CMS structure
MaintenanceLowHigh (plugins, server updates)

When Should You Use Jamstack?

While Jamstack is great, it’s not a silver bullet. Here’s when it makes sense:

  • You need high performance for SEO or conversions
  • Your team prefers modern development workflows
  • You want to decouple the frontend and backend
  • You’re building a content-heavy or marketing-focused site

On the flip side, if your project requires heavy server-side logic like user authentication, real-time messaging, or complex database queries, you might want to use a hybrid approach—for example, with Next.js’ API routes.

SEO and Jamstack: A Perfect Match

Google loves fast websites, and Jamstack delivers. Since pages are pre-rendered, bots can crawl your site easily. Structured data, meta tags, and Open Graph info are easier to implement cleanly. Plus, using tools like Headless CMSs (e.g., Contentful, Sanity, Strapi) allows for full control over your content and its SEO elements.

Bonus tip: You can use platforms like Surfer SEO or Frase.io to fine-tune your content before deploying it on a Jamstack site. These tools help you align with SEO best practices based on competitor analysis.

My Experience with Jamstack

When I migrated my own blog from WordPress to Jamstack using Netlify and a Gatsby frontend, the results were almost immediate. Page load times dropped by 60%, bounce rates decreased, and my content started ranking higher without changing a word.

The developer workflow became smoother too. I could version control my content, deploy from GitHub, and preview changes before going live. It felt more like software development than traditional website management—and that was a good thing.

Challenges of Jamstack

No solution is without its drawbacks. Some of the challenges you might face include:

  • Learning Curve: If you’re new to APIs or frontend frameworks, there’s a bit to learn.
  • Dynamic Content Limitations: Real-time features (like live chat or frequent user-generated updates) need workarounds.
  • Tool Overload: There are many Jamstack tools and services—choosing the right ones can be overwhelming.

But with time, these hurdles become minor compared to the benefits.

Conclusion

Jamstack is more than just a trend—it’s a movement toward a faster, safer, and more scalable web. Whether you’re a developer looking for a better workflow or a business aiming for better performance and SEO, Jamstack is worth exploring.

The modern web is moving toward speed, modularity, and security. Jamstack delivers on all three fronts. As more tools and platforms embrace this architecture, we’re only scratching the surface of what’s possible.

Find more Tech content at:
https://allinsightlab.com/category/technology/

Leave a Reply

Your email address will not be published. Required fields are marked *